The Real Benefits of Staging Your Property

When it comes to selling your home, there are a few simple things that genuinely shift the needle — and staging is one of them. I’m not talking about spending thousands or turning your house into something out of a TV makeover show. I mean smart, realistic staging that highlights the best features of your home and helps buyers picture themselves living there.

After years of selling in East Cork, we’ve seen the difference repeatedly. Two houses, same layout, same location, same guide price — one staged, one not. The staged one always gets more viewings and stronger offers. It’s not rocket science; it’s just presentation done right.

1. Better First Impressions

Buyers make decisions quickly. A clean, bright, well-presented home immediately puts them at ease. It shows the property has been looked after and gets them focusing on what they like, rather than what they want to rip out.

2. Higher Offers and Stronger Bidding

A staged home feels more valuable. It looks cared for, move-in ready, and worth stretching for. We regularly see staged properties exceed asking price because buyers are far more confident when the home presents well.

3. Buyers Can Actually Visualise the Space

Empty rooms look smaller. Cluttered rooms distract. Staging hits the sweet spot — it shows how a room works, how furniture fits, and how the home flows. Once a buyer starts imagining their own life there, the sale is halfway done.

4. Better Photos = More Online Attention

Most buyers start their search on their phone. The sharper the photos, the more clicks you get. Staged homes simply photograph better, which means more enquiries, more viewings, and a faster route to Sale Agreed.

5. It Signals Care and Quality

Staging isn’t just about aesthetics. It sends a message that the home has been minded. Buyers pick up on this immediately and are far more willing to bid confidently when they feel the property has been properly maintained.

6. Faster Selling Time

Well-presented homes don’t linger on the market. Staging removes hesitation, reduces objections, and makes the property feel turn-key — which is exactly what most buyers want.

7. It Helps Us Market Your Home Properly

Staging gives us stronger photography, better videos, and a more compelling story to tell buyers. When your home looks good, it arms us with the tools to negotiate harder on your behalf.
